Flock gets points for XHTML, but

  • it doesn't seem to grok <abbr> (which makes hCalendar hard) nor <q>
  • the drupal spreadfirefox theme uses XHTML strict where blockquote can only contain block elements, but flock puts other stuff there. I'm pretty happy with flock's use of transitional XHTML; I'd be happy to change the theme. But I want them to get along, one way or another.
